Ethical Considerations of Undress AI Images
While the technology behind undress AI images is fascinating, it raises several ethical concerns that must be addressed:
Consent and Privacy
One of the most pressing ethical issues surrounding undress AI images is the question of consent. Using someone’s likeness without their permission can lead to serious privacy violations. It’s crucial for developers and users of this technology to prioritize consent and ensure that individuals have control over how their images are used.
Potential for Abuse
The potential for misuse of undress AI technology is significant. It can lead to the creation of non-consensual explicit content, which can be damaging to individuals and communities. Safeguards must be put in place to prevent such abuses, and legal frameworks should be established to protect individuals’ rights.
Impact on Body Image
The proliferation of altered images can also contribute to unrealistic body standards and negatively impact individuals’ self-esteem. It’s vital for society to promote body positivity and ensure that technology is used to uplift rather than diminish self-image.
